Abstract

1,071,682. Plate type heat exchangers. HEAD WRIGHTSON & CO. Ltd. July 9, 1965 [April 10, 1964], No. 14918/64. Heading F4S. A heat exchanger comprises a stack of corrugated rhomboidal plates 11 supported in a frame 12, the corrugations of each plate being at an angle to those of the adjacent plates. Adjacent plates may be in contact or spaced from one another. One side of each of the fluid spaces formed between adjacent plates is closed by a sealing member 16, the sealing members on one side being staggered in relation to those on the other side. Each sealing member 16 may be a flat strip, as shown, shaped and sealed to the corrugations, or channel-shaped and sealed to a flange formed at the edges of the plates 11, or an L-shaped flange integral with one plate and sealed to a planar flange on the adjacent plate. The two fluids flow in alternate spaces and in opposing directions between their respective headers 19, 19 and 20, 20 of detachable side covers 18 which seal with frame 12 and end plates 17.
